This casual gay bar, in a quieter residential stretch south of Schöneberg, is a relaxed alternative to the bigger clubs up the road. Since 2010, it's been a local favorite for a straightforward night out.
The music leans into pop oldies and Schlager classics. On Friday and Saturday nights, the dance floor picks up when DJs are playing. They also host occasional cabaret performances.
It's the kind of place where you can come early for a quiet drink and stay as late as you like. Closing times are deliberately flexible, letting the night run at its own speed.
This isn't for scene-hunting. It's for a real connection, with a welcoming crowd and no pretense.
